Nigeria – Jim Iyke: “Entertainment Is Where Demons Live” | Nigerian Bulletin

Nollywood actor Jim Iyke has sparked reactions after making strong claims about the entertainment industry during an appearance on the Joey Akan Podcast, according to reports. Iyke described entertainment as a space that often encourages self-glorification rather than the celebration of God, saying: “There is no bigger enabler than entertainment. This is where demons live.” He claimed the industry’s structure promotes values he associates with Satanism, arguing that many aspects of entertainment do not reflect godly principles. He asked: “What in entertainment glorifies God, except you intentionally or consciously go for Him?” He acknowledged that individuals can still seek God through creativity and personal conviction.
